Fable 3

Fable 3 DLC: Traitors Keep

  Traitors Keep is the latest installment of DLC out for Fable 3 and for 560 Microsoft Points, it’s a pretty good deal for what you get. Along with a new and interesting quest line, you get 10 new achievements worth 250 gamerscore, an in-game guard outfit, and a new dog breed, unfortunately though, no […]